The reason the bolt stays back on my Draco is because I installed a "Mike Krebbs Custom Safety Selector Switch" - you should be able to find them on Amazon or OutdoorBunker for about $50.00. Excellent upgrade for any AK47 as you can lock the bolt back and manipulate the safety with just your trigger finger. Thanks for watching!

@urungutang It is an NcStar Tactical 4 Reticle Red Dot Sight (Item #: D4B). Works pretty well, but I would recommend using Locktite on the front screw that holds the mounting platform and red dot assembly together (they come apart with the recoil). I also purchased an AIM (looks almost identical but just a little bit cheaper) and the quality doesn't come close to this NcStar...
